Greg Bear


<span class="SFPTagline"> From SCIFIPEDIA </span>

Greg Dale Bear (August 20, 1951–) is the best-selling author of more than 30 novels of science fiction and fantasy, including Blood Music, The Forge of God, Anvil of Stars, Moving Mars, and Darwin's Radio.

He has been awarded two Hugos and five Nebulas for his fiction and has been called the "best working writer of hard science fiction" by The Ultimate Encyclopedia of Science Fiction. He serves as the advisory board chair of The Science Fiction Museum and Hall of Fame in Seattle, Washington.
